Cyberhive

Organization Overview

Cyberhive is located in San Diego, CA. The organization was established in 2014. According to its NTEE Classification (W99) the organization is classified as: Public & Societal Benefit N.E.C., under the broad grouping of Public & Societal Benefit and related organizations. This organization is an independent organization and not affiliated with a larger national or regional group of organizations. Cyberhive is a 501(c)(3) and as such, is described as a "Charitable or Religous organization or a private foundation" by the IRS.

For the year ending 12/2023, Cyberhive generated $424.6k in total revenue. This represents relatively stable growth, over the past 9 years the organization has increased revenue by an average of 3.2% each year. All expenses for the organization totaled $434.8k during the year ending 12/2023. While expenses have increased by 4.1% per year over the past 9 years. They've been increasing with an increasing level of total revenue. You can explore the organizations financials more deeply in the financial statements section below.

Describe the Organization's Mission:

Part 3 - Line 1

CYBERHIVE IS A CHARITABLE AND EDUCATIONAL ORGANIZATION FOUNDED TO PROMOTE AND FOSTER TECHNOLOGICAL EDUATION, VETERAN TRANSITION AND TRAINING, AND ENTREPRENEURIAL ACTIVITY BY PROVIDING MENTORING, EDUCATION, TRAINING AND GUIDANCE TO INDIVIDUALS AND ORGANIZATIONS INVOLVED WITH EXISTING OR INTENDING TO FORM EARLY STAGE CYBER-SECURITY AND TECHNOLOGY ORGANIZATIONS. CYBERHIVE'S ACTIVITIES WILL PROVIDE THESE INDIVIDUALS AND ORGANIZATIONS WITH THE EDUCATION AND TRAINING THEY NEED TO OPEN A GATEWAY TO INCREASE ENTREPRENEURIAL ACTIVITIES AND DECREASE UNEMPLOYMENT IN SAN DIEGO. SPECIFICALLY, THE EDUCATIONAL AND CHARITABLE ACTIVITIES CONDUCTED BY CYBERHIVE WILL PROMOTE AND SUPPORT ENTREPRENEURISM, REDUCE UNEMPLOYMENT AND UNDEREMPLOYMENT, IMPROVE ECONOMIC DEVELOPMENT AND PROMOTE SOCIAL WELFARE.
